Politische Bildung meets Kulturelle Bildung

Abstract

This book focuses on the relation between citizenship education and cultural education. It provides answers to the question of where the line between citizenship and cultural education is to be drawn—and if there is any at all. The issue of which approaches to cultural education can be productive for citizenship education is also raised. The articles the book contains introduce the chances offered by and limits to citizenship and cultural education as well as concrete approaches to identifying a link between them. This includes citizenship education through literature, theatre, music, fashion, computer games, etc. With contributions byFrederik Achatz, Michele Barricelli, Santina Battaglia, Helle Becker, Anja Besand, Sabine Dengel, Werner Friedrichs, Markus Gloe, Annegret Jansen, Ingo Juchler, Paul Mecheril,Tonio Oeftering, Sebastian Puhl, Sven Rößler, David Salomon.
